Fire Kevin Gilbride! Perry Fewell, too! Sorry, New York Giants' fans, head coach Tom Coughlin said Monday that is not happening.

Has Tom Coughlin considered any changes to the staff or play-calling responsibilities? "No."

So, Gilbride will be calling the offensive plays Thursday against the Chicago Bears and Fewell will be handling defensive signals.
Coughlin did not offer any insight as to what might change going forward, but he did have this to say:
Coughlin: "We've spent a lot of time in reflection in that game (Philly) and it has not been pleasant" #NYG

What can Coughlin tell his beleaguered players at this point?
Coughlin: "It's the same message. Work hard. Prepare. Stay together. Stay focused." #NYG
